Before germinating the cannabis seeds, soak the rockwool cubes in water for several hours. Make sure that all parts of the cubes are immersed in water. When the cubes are already containing enough amount of water, put the pot seed in the hole of the cube and push it using tweezers until it gets to the bottom. Do not hold the seed using your hands to avoid the seed being contaminated.


If you have bought rockwool cubes with no holes on them, make a hole using a toothpick.
